Position Overview:

We are seeking a Captain to join our Marine Operations team based in Falmouth, MA. The ideal candidate will be responsible for operating a 25-foot vessel, ensuring the safety of all passengers on board, and the safe navigation of the vessel in accordance with all COLREGs. This role requires collaboration with cross-functional teams to ensure seamless maritime operations.

This is a full-time position split between two Captains to maintain consistent service coverage. The goal is to ensure safe, reliable ferry service to Martha’s Vineyard for flight crews and personnel year-round, while mitigating risks related to scheduling or mechanical disruptions.

Key Responsibilities:

Area of Responsibility (AOR): Vineyard Sound, with homeport in Falmouth, MA and destination Vineyard Haven, MA.
Operate a 25-foot Response Boat Small (RBS) vessel in all weather conditions.
Perform mooring, docking, and line-handling evolutions.
Ensure the safety and conduct of all crew, passengers, and vessel operations.
Conduct fueling evolutions safely and in compliance with environmental and safety standards.
Record Keeping
Support Ground Operations at Martha’s Vineyard Airport, as directed.
Perform vessel maintenance, including:
Routine cleanliness and upkeep
Preventative maintenance
Electrical system checks
Outboard engine monitoring and basic service
Execute other duties as assigned by supervisor, including support for helicopter operations and related ground logistics.
Qualifications & Requirements:

Required:

Active Merchant Mariner Credential (MMC) with OUPV or Master 25, 50, or 100 GRT Near Coastal endorsement.
Minimum 4 years of experience in a captain or similar maritime role.
Demonstrated knowledge of COLREGs, navigation, boat handling, SOLAS, risk assessment, and leadership.
Current First Aid and CPR certification.

Preferred:

Honda Outboard Technician certification.
Reside within 30 minutes of Falmouth, MA.
Possess a Master endorsement on MMC.
Radar experience.
Strong mechanical aptitude

About HeliService USA:

First operation of its kind in the U.S. to support offshore wind operations. We conduct missions sets that include crew change, technician & cargo hoisting, and helicopter EMS services.
Rapidly expanding U.S. veteran owned & operated small business.
